It seems like Amazon does not want to miss a single chance to win over Holiday buyers. After introducing quarterly installments on its latest tablet, 8.9-inch Fire HDX, the online retail giant has now come up with one more impressive offer.

Amazon announced Monday that any Amazon or Android user downloading an app or game from the Amazon app store between Dec. 24 and 28 will be credited with $5  that can be redeemed in the next round of purchase from the online store.

 "Customers look to Amazon to provide the best deals in the industry throughout the holiday season and the Amazon Appstore is no exception," said Mike George, vice president of Amazon Appstore and Games, in a press release. "The combination of a $5 credit to use in the Amazon Appstore and the expansive deals we are offering for Christmas week will help customers add exciting apps and games to their devices this holiday season."

 The offer is pretty exciting as Amazon will be offering more than 1000 games and  apps on the store as a part of  Christmas celebrations, which can be downloaded both on the Android and Amazon smartphones.

Alongside the credit addition, Amazon has also come up with free app of the day bundles where the customers will get a free app alongside a paid app from the store. The other apps will be also offered on a much rebated price (around 50-60) percent. The offer is on for two days, Dec. 25 and 26.  

Also the people downloading apps between Dec. 23- 28 will receive a free app specific to the dates besides the credit. The details are listed below.
